Output eec5feaca5411047121642c3bc57a179f386c2a0d4ece7feacb7cf80da8fe998:0

value
100000
script pubkey
OP_0 OP_PUSHBYTES_32 e150987af07c970bb1a3d1914239666bf5fc2495eaa10e4b96d9034235d268c5
address
tb1qu9gfs7hs0jtshvdr6xg5ywtxd06lcfy4a2ssujukmyp5ydwjdrzs5t2ztl
transaction
eec5feaca5411047121642c3bc57a179f386c2a0d4ece7feacb7cf80da8fe998
confirmations
10520
spent
true